Quick orientation for the incoming director. We've overhauled commissions effective next quarter: base rate drops from 6% to 4.5%, but accelerators kick in at 110% of target, topping out at 9%. Renewals on the Pellway product line now count at half weight, which ruffled a few feathers in the Greymarsh office. Clawbacks apply to cancellations within 90 days. Payout moves to monthly. Questions go through regional leads first, please. The confidential rationale tied to next year's plans sits just below.

internal memo for kawip-hadug: Headcount on the Wenwyn team goes from 7 to 140 by the end of January. Gross margin on Wenwyn came in at 20 percent against a plan of 15 percent.

## Changed
Renamed ORDERS_SOFTDEL_FLAG to ORDERS_SOFT_DELETE_ENABLED in the Cartwheel service for clarity. Behavior unchanged: rows in the orders table get a deleted_at timestamp instead of hard removal. Old name is still read with a deprecation warning until v4. The purge worker also needs its datastore credential, which sits directly below this entry.

sealed setting: LEDGER_TOKEN13=b4a1a6f880cb4

Re: hot-reload in `confwatch.go` — the reload loop works, but debounce is too aggressive; rapid edits to the Pellbrook config file can drop the final write. Suggest watching for a quiet period rather than a fixed delay, and validating the parsed config before swapping the pointer. Also log the old/new hash on each reload. For reference, the current tuning constants are shown below.

limits module of yadug-tawip:
QUOTAS = {
    "julael": 705,
    "kasael": 903,
    "druwyn": 489,
}